What does "Protected by LimeLock" mean?
LimeLock® is a secure Internet service, dedicated to protect privacy of Internet users by hiding their contact information from unauthorized or abusive use by third parties.
When you submit this form LimeLock® technology will immidiately anonymize your e-mail address and phone numbers. This way you will be effectively protected from spam, or from unauthorized and unwanted phone calls or e-mail traffic.
Dangers to your privacy
Most web sites promise to protect your privacy, however they often lack the necessary tools to guarantee it in reality. Leakages and redistribution of e-mail and phone lists by third parties became common practices.
Once your personal contact information is leaked, you might face increase in unwanted e-mail messages (spam), or become a target for telemarketers.
How does LimeLock technology work
When this form is submitted, LimeLock® technology will record your real phone numbers and e-mail address, and assign anonymized aliases, for example abc123@anon.limelock.com, and (906) 449-1234
When movers call or e-mail those aliases our system automatically relays the calls and e-mail messages to your real numbers and e-mail address.
